WASHINGTON, July 20 -- Sen. Rand Paul issued the following press release:

Today, U.S. Senator Rand Paul (R-KY), Chairman of the Senate Committee on Homeland Security and Governmental Affairs, released documents showing that U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) prepared a formal targeting action to question and search Peter Daszak, President of EcoHealth Alliance, upon his return to the United States from the World Health Organization's investigation into the origins of COVID-19 - before the FBI intervened and asked agents to stand down.
